Output 521584190ccb4c486206e6a58551a0ac045bf7d8dd29949ead76ec6a4f9ae4d6:2

value
18504
script pubkey
OP_0 OP_PUSHBYTES_20 06f2a9d395a16e29cb4374b666821acfc2cea0d2
address
tb1qqme2n5u459hznj6rwjmxdqs6elpvagxjhjhn4k
transaction
521584190ccb4c486206e6a58551a0ac045bf7d8dd29949ead76ec6a4f9ae4d6